Output 32f0a05c5d9636c4b661f503427c298e349e4bdf198be2e35213717184c399a7:1

value
502723776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ec25af0a23f6e3e2a2905e59214f1069e742e2e OP_EQUAL
address
37QreUYNVhzCM6p6WMh7YfAnMibwps9v25
transaction
32f0a05c5d9636c4b661f503427c298e349e4bdf198be2e35213717184c399a7
confirmations
341084
spent
true